#c21151 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c21151 is composed of 76.1% red, 6.7%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 41.4%. #c21151 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22a2 with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#c21151 color description : Strong pink.
The hexadecimal color #c21151 has RGB values of R:194, G:17,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.58,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12718417.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0106 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716267 is the less saturated color, while #d2014d is the most saturated one.
